Fiery Lace

Good Evening Crafters. I hope you are all well. Tonight I have another card for you to see, I wasnt sure how this one was going to end up, but I must say I do like it in the end.



I have used Dreamees Fiery Flower Stamp
Backing papers from Dreamees Back to Basics Cd
Swirls cut from Dreamees Cuttables range cds ( These cds are GSD files to use with cutting machines )
Walnut Stain Distress Ink Pad
Lace from my stash

I stamped  the fiery flower out 10 times  onto cream paper using the  walnut stain ink pad.
Printed out backing papers from the cd in pink, pink stripe onto cream paper, and cream paper from my stash.
I then matt and layered the papers leaving a narrow border.
I then cut a piece of the pink paper 10 cm square to make the topper, matt and layered again as you can see in the photo.
Before sticking this to the base card I run an edge of double sided tape to the reverse , in which I pleated the cream cotton lace. I then used foam tape to attach the topper to the base card.
Then I attached the swirls.
Pulled up the petals on all the flowers attached 1 to each corner of the card, the flowers for the topper I used two for each one again pulling up the petals and glueing two together off setting them. Making the flower look fuller.

I am here again today to show you another card I have made with Dreamees products. This card has been made using the Silhouette Butterfly Stamp Set, available at http://www.dreamees.org.uk/silhouette-butterfly-stamp-set-936-p.asp also distress markers.
First of all I distressed the edges of the base card using peeled paint distress ink pad.
I then printed a lilac backing from Dreamees Elegance Collection cd rom  ( http://www.dreamees.org.uk/the-elegance-collection-cd-583-p.asp ) to which I added to the base card leaving a narrow border.
I then cut a small piece of card, and using the stems in the stamp set, used the distress markers peeled paint and dusty concord, brushed these colours straight onto the stamp, making the lovely effect as you can see on the card, I did this several times to give the effect I required.
Then mounting this topper onto another piece of card already distressed with the peeled paint ink pad. I also created a border using the same technique.
I attached the border across the base card, added the topper, attaching a small bow to the base of the stems created.
I then used some teardrop paper lace which will be on sale shortly on our web site and at shows all ready cut for you distressed again with peeled paint .
I added  3 small rolled flowers  swirl and pearls  just to embellish and finishe the card of.
